Grabbed the camera and headed out to Fox Island yesterday, noonish. It was sunny and beautiful when i entered the water but 84 mins. later i surfaced to clouds and rain. Vis was typical...maybe 10', mucky. Lots of giant nudis out and I was hoping I'd actually see one feed on an tube-dwelling anenome. But, no such luck. Here's some pics of the usual crowd at FIWW...
